Home to the NJCAA Division I Men’s Basketball Championship since 1949 and home to the 2017-2019, 2021 and 2023 NJCAA DI Volleyball Championship. Since 2021 the Sports Arena has hosted the National DII Christian Homeschool Basketball Championship, and the KCAC Volleyball Championship since 2017.On June 3, 1979, the Kemper Arena hosted a convention of America’s top architects. Posted on July 7, 2023. The Kansas State Wildcats officially unveiled the new Morgan Family Volleyball Arena in Manhattan on Friday showcasing one of the most beautiful projects in the Big 12. The new spot for the Kansas State Volleyball team to compete features multiple different training areas, brand-new main courts, and comes with purple ...Kansas City has had teams in all five of the major, professional sports leagues; three major league teams remain today. The Kansas City Royals of Major League Baseball became the first American League expansion team to reach the playoffs (), to reach the World Series (), and to win the World Series (1985; against the state-rival St. Louis Cardinals in the "Show-Me Series"). "Many [sports arenas], like Kemper, became symbols of their community." 1976 – Just two years after Kemper Arena opened, Kansas City was picked to host the Republican National Convention.INTRUST Bank Arena is a multi-purpose indoor arena located in downtown Wichita, Kansas. The arena opened its doors to the public on January 2, 2010, and has since become a popular venue for concerts, sporting events, and other entertainment events.
